OK, heres the deal. You have nine diamonds, all exactly the same in size and looks, etc. But, one of them is heavier, and you cannot tell which is heavier by picking them up. You don't know which one, so you have a pair of scales (ie. scales which have two bowls and move up and down depending on the other bowl's weight. Like this: http://www.go.ednet.ns.ca/~ip96003/scales.gif )

So, in order to do so you have to weigh them. But, you can only weigh a set of diamonds twice. How do you do it? You can weigh more than one diamond per scale.

OK, how about this?

1. Split them into three groups of three: ABC, DEF, GHI

2. Weigh ABC vs. DEF
-a. They're equal, so the heavy one is in GHI -> go to 2a
-b. ABC is heavier -> go to 2b
-c. DEF is heavier -> go to 2c

2a. Weigh G vs. H; the heavier one is the one we want, and if they're equal, it's I

2b. Weigh A vs. B; the heavier one is the one we want, and if they're equal, it's C

2c. Weigh D vs. E; the heavier one is the one we want, and if they're equal, it's F

At no point is a diamond weighed more than twice.
